Arctic Inspiration Prize (AIP), an award celebrating Northern achievements, announced their finalists for the award’s three categories last week.
Each year AIP awards one $1 million prize, up to four $500,000 prizes, and up to seven $100,000 prizes to organizations across the three territories proposing projects “by the North, for the North.” The goal is to enable Northern projects across fields of education, health, arts, traditional knowledge, language, science, and others. The $100,000 prize category is dedicated entirely to youth programming.
